Main changes to Fórmula 1 cars for 2026
The cars for the 2026 season will be considerably different from the current ones. The weight reduction by 30 kilos, reaching a minimum of 768 kilos, aims to increase agility on the tracks. Além In addition, the wheelbase was shortened, and the overall width decreased to improve handling.
Active aerodynamics marks the first large-scale implementation in the category’s history. The front and rear wings will be able to automatically change positions between high load modes in curves and low resistance on straights. Essa technology replaces previous mechanisms and requires greater management by pilots.
- Reduction of 20 centimeters in the total length of single-seaters;
- Reduction of 10 centimeters in the width of the body;
- Revised tread to generate more efficient downforce;
- Smaller wheels with partial covers to reduce turbulence.
These changes aim for closer races and more responsive cars.
Changes to power units and fuels
The power units will undergo a radical transformation from 2026 onwards. The energy division will be balanced at 50% electrical and 50% thermal, with a significant increase in the power of the electrical component. The MGU-H was removed, simplifying the hybrid system.
Sustainable advanced fuels become mandatory across the grid. Produzidos from non-fossil sources, they maintain performance similar to current ones, but with zero net carbon emissions. Todas teams tested preliminary versions in previous seasons.
Total power remains close to current levels, but with greater emphasis on energy recovery. Drivers will have manual control over electrical power release modes in specific race situations.
Overtaking system replaces traditional DRS
DRS will be completely eliminated from 2026. In its place will be Modo Manual of Ultrapassagem, which provides extra electrical boost to the chasing car. Activation occurs when the driver is less than one second behind the rival ahead.
This system combines with active aerodynamics to reduce drag on the straights. The car in front maintains the standard configuration, while the pursuer gains a temporary power advantage. The measure aims for more natural and strategic overtaking.
Engineers adjusted parameters to prevent excessive abuse. Testes simulations indicate an increase in the number of maneuvers during the tests.

Historical comparison with previous regulatory transitions
Significant regulation changes have always altered hierarchies in the Fórmula 1. The introduction of ground effect cars in 2022 initially caught several teams by surprise. Mercedes faced porpoising issues that directly affected Hamilton’s performance.
That season, George Russell outperformed the seven-time champion in several qualifying races. Adapting to the new behavior of single-seaters required months of continuous development. Equipes like Ferrari and Red Bull capitalized better early on.
Previous transitions, such as the 2014 hybrid era, have also redistributed forces. Mercedes dominated thanks to advanced preparation on the power unit. Outras teams took years to reach a similar competitive level.

Energy management becomes a decisive factor in racing
Pilots take a more active role in energy control in 2026. Botões manuals allow strategic release of stored electrical power. The decision directly impacts positions in overtaking or defending.
Teams train extensive simulations to optimize battery strategies. Braking recovery gains greater importance with the increase in the electrical component. Long Corridas will require precise planning to avoid premature depletion.
This element adds a tactical layer to the tests. Pilotos with better management feel can gain significant advantages in direct battles.
